The volume of hydrogen liberated at STP by treating 2.4 g of magnesium with excess of hydrochloric acid is _________ × 10–2 L Given : Molar volume of gas is 22.4 L at STP. Molar mass of magnesium is 24 g mol–1

Answer: .

💡 Solution & Explanation

Mg + 2HCl  MgCl2 + H2 1 mole 1 mole 2.4 g of Mg = 0.1 moles 0.1 moles So volume of H2 gas evolved at STP = 0.1  22.4 = 2.24 litre
